The Role of the Seed and Hashing

The "provably fair" aspect hinges on the use of seeds and hashing. A seed is a random string of characters generated by both the server and the client (the player’s device). These seeds are combined and hashed through a cryptographic algorithm. The resulting hash determines the crash point. Because players have access to the client seed and can independently verify the server seed (typically revealed after the round), they can reproduce the hash and confirm the fairness of the outcome. This level of transparency is a significant advantage over traditional casino games, where the inner workings remain opaque. Learning about these technical details helps alleviate concerns about fairness and promotes confidence in the game's integrity.

Developing Effective Strategies

Successful crash game players don’t rely solely on luck. They employ a variety of strategies to mitigate risk and maximize potential profits. One popular approach is the Martingale strategy, which invol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the goal of recouping previous losses and securing a small profit when you eventually win. However, this strategy requires a substantial bankroll and carries significant risk, as consecutive losses can quickly escalate your bets to unsustainable levels. Another common tactic is to set a target multiplier and automatically cash out when that point is reached, regardless of how early or late in the round it occurs. This disciplined approach helps to avoid impulsive decisions driven by greed or fear. It's crucial to remember that no strategy guarantees success, but a well-defined plan can significantly improve your odds.
